Hey Mara,

Handing over on-call for the Ledgerbeam billing worker. We're mid-rollout on the new blue-green setup: green is taking 20% of traffic and looking fine, but don't flip the rest until the reconciliation job finishes tonight. If invoices stack up, just drain green and route back to blue — the runbook's step four covers it. Support folks: tickets about duplicate charges during the cutover are expected and safe to merge. Questions about the deploy itself should go to the payments platform inbox.

escalation mailbox, fajef-fawig: ulair_briius_drueth@paliqcorp.example

# Basement Archive Room — Night Access

The archive room under Pellworth House holds old contracts and the tape backups. Night shift: take stairwell C, not the lift (it's switched off after midnight). Lights are on a timer by the door — slap the button as you go in. Sign the logbook, even at 3am, yes really. The keypad by the door takes the code below.

staff pass of fahap-tajeg = bdg-FT-6

# Break-Glass: Catalog Cache Invalidation

Scope: the Pinrow product catalog at Veldstone Retail. If stale prices persist after a purge and the Hollowmere invalidation queue is wedged, use break-glass to flush the edge tier directly. Contractors: get verbal sign-off from the catalog lead first. Steps: open the Hollowmere admin shell, select emergency-flush, confirm the tenant, and run it once — repeated flushes thrash the origin. Access is logged and expires after 20 minutes. Unseal the admin shell with the passphrase below.

recovery phrase for kahop-tajog: istix-casvan

Leadership Review — Harbourline Pilot Churn

Quick heads-up for branch managers: churn in the Harbourline pilot crept up to 14% last month, mostly small accounts who never got past onboarding. The Dunmere and Kettlewick branches are outliers in a good way — their walk-through sessions seem to be working, so we'll roll that approach out next cycle. Pricing tweaks are also on the table. Our plan for the next phase is summarised below.

internal memo for kawip-hadug: Headcount on the Wenwyn team goes from 7 to 140 by the end of January. Gross margin on Wenwyn came in at 20 percent against a plan of 15 percent.